AXT Inc's stock surged 14.21% in pre-market trading, marking a significant upward movement for the semiconductor materials company following a period of sustained profit-taking that had pushed the stock into oversold territory.
The technical rebound phase is supported by fundamental factors, including China's continued tightening of export controls on indium phosphide (InP) and upstream high-purity indium. With rejection rates for export applications from U.S. and Japanese companies exceeding 80%, AXT benefits as a leading U.S.-listed InP substrate supplier in a globally constrained market where it and two other companies collectively control over 90% of production capacity.
Additional tailwinds came from the broader semiconductor equipment and optical communication sectors, which rallied strongly in overnight trading within a positive market context for technology stocks driven by broader geopolitical developments.
